              precision    recall  f1-score   support

         acc       0.99      0.58      0.73      2000
         acf       0.99      0.96      0.97      2000
         acr       1.00      0.01      0.01      2002
         agu       1.00      0.47      0.64      2000
         amh       1.00      0.99      0.99      9509
         amu       1.00      0.65      0.79      2086
         ara       1.00      0.87      0.93     15000
         azg       1.00      0.67      0.80      2014
         ben       0.99      1.00      1.00     13109
         bzd       1.00      0.58      0.74      2002
         bzj       1.00      0.10      0.19      4000
         caa       1.00      0.74      0.85      2001
         cab       1.00      0.63      0.77      4283
         cak       0.75      0.95      0.84      4005
         cbm       0.96      0.93      0.95      2004
         cco       1.00      1.00      1.00      2002
         chd       1.00      0.69      0.81      2171
         chf       0.99      0.89      0.94      2000
         chq       1.00      0.81      0.90      2000
         chz       1.00      0.99      0.99      2013
         cjp       1.00      0.31      0.47      2004
         cke       0.93      0.82      0.87      2001
         cki       0.83      0.85      0.84      2003
         ckw       0.83      0.90      0.86      2001
         cle       1.00      1.00      1.00      2091
         cnl       0.91      1.00      0.95      2051
         cpa       0.99      1.00      0.99      2137
         crn       1.00      0.38      0.56      2085
         cso       0.95      1.00      0.97      2006
         cta       1.00      0.76      0.87      2000
         cti       0.98      0.65      0.78      2001
         ctp       1.00      0.52      0.68      2000
         ctu       0.74      1.00      0.85      4001
         cuc       1.00      0.95      0.97      2138
         cuk       1.00      0.94      0.97      2891
         cut       1.00      0.91      0.95      2015
         cux       1.00      0.98      0.99      2001
         deu       1.00      0.65      0.79     15000
         emp       1.00      0.99      0.99      2147
         eng       0.91      0.00      0.01     16101
         fas       0.68      1.00      0.81     15000
         fra       0.82      0.95      0.88     15000
         guj       0.50      1.00      0.66      8044
         gym       0.99      1.00      0.99      4007
         hat       1.00      0.33      0.50      6051
         hau       0.99      0.63      0.77      6030
         hch       1.00      0.42      0.59      2809
         hin       1.00      0.87      0.93     15000
         hns       1.00      0.06      0.11      2002
         hus       0.99      0.83      0.90      2004
         huv       0.45      1.00      0.62      2012
         hva       1.00      0.75      0.85      2002
         ind       1.00      0.89      0.94     15000
         ita       0.99      0.92      0.95     15000
         ixl       1.00      0.03      0.06      2002
         jac       1.00      0.39      0.56      2023
         jam       0.91      0.12      0.21      2045
         jav       0.92      0.94      0.93      6136
         jic       1.00      0.96      0.98      2001
         jpn       0.59      0.98      0.74     19995
         kan       1.00      1.00      1.00      9543
         kek       0.99      0.67      0.80      4018
         kjb       1.00      0.56      0.72      2001
         knj       1.00      0.37      0.54      2000
         kor       0.98      1.00      0.99     15000
         kvn       1.00      0.93      0.97      2892
         lac       0.99      0.90      0.94      2000
         lad       1.00      0.40      0.57      2132
         maa       0.23      1.00      0.38      2058
         maj       0.77      0.97      0.86      2116
         mam       1.00      0.90      0.95      4003
         maq       1.00      0.97      0.98      2003
         mar       0.99      1.00      0.99     10230
         mau       0.48      1.00      0.65      4588
         maz       1.00      0.89      0.94      2000
         mco       1.00      0.99      1.00      4327
         mib       1.00      0.87      0.93      2000
         mie       0.98      0.99      0.98      2000
         mig       1.00      0.85      0.92      2001
         mih       1.00      0.01      0.02      2000
         mil       0.99      1.00      0.99      2001
         mio       1.00      0.12      0.22      2000
         mir       0.99      1.00      0.99      2267
         mit       0.96      0.99      0.97      2008
         miz       1.00      0.94      0.97      2000
         mjc       0.99      0.95      0.97      2000
         mks       1.00      0.94      0.97      2001
         mop       1.00      0.00      0.00      2002
         mpm       1.00      0.21      0.34      2000
         mto       0.89      0.99      0.94      2341
         mvc       0.66      0.97      0.78      2001
         mvj       0.86      0.96      0.91      2001
         mxb       1.00      0.71      0.83      2001
         mxp       1.00      0.91      0.95      2157
         mxq       1.00      0.98      0.99      2138
         mxt       0.95      0.91      0.93      2000
         mxv       0.97      0.78      0.87      2020
         nah       0.67      1.00      0.80     32778
         ncl       1.00      0.64      0.78      2235
         nhg       1.00      0.72      0.84      2260
         nld       0.29      1.00      0.45     16370
         noa       0.97      0.89      0.93      2023
         ntp       1.00      0.74      0.85      2284
         ood       1.00      0.59      0.74      2002
         ote       1.00      0.09      0.17      2000
         otm       0.98      0.98      0.98      2000
         otn       0.97      0.27      0.43      2002
         otq       1.00      0.12      0.21      2000
         ots       0.50      0.99      0.67      2000
         pan       1.00      1.00      1.00      4003
         pap       0.99      0.29      0.45      4033
         pls       1.00      0.68      0.81      2006
         pob       0.89      0.97      0.93      2001
         poe       0.98      0.99      0.99      2061
         poh       0.99      0.96      0.98      2002
         poi       0.97      1.00      0.98      2098
         pol       1.00      0.95      0.98     15000
         por       1.00      0.49      0.66     15000
         que       1.00      0.80      0.89     70016
         qut       0.19      1.00      0.32      2001
         rus       0.99      0.99      0.99     15000
         sab       1.00      0.92      0.96      2000
         sja       1.00      0.88      0.93      2083
         spa       0.73      0.95      0.82     16149
         stp       0.96      0.97      0.96      2000
         swa       1.00      0.13      0.24     14257
         tac       0.83      0.98      0.90      2010
         tam       1.00      1.00      1.00     12809
         tar       1.00      0.95      0.97      2022
         tcf       0.32      1.00      0.49      2023
         tee       1.00      0.86      0.92      2302
         tel       1.00      1.00      1.00      9133
         tfr       0.98      0.81      0.89      2000
         tgl       1.00      0.91      0.95     14141
         tha       1.00      0.99      1.00     15000
         tku       0.56      0.95      0.71      2427
         toc       0.81      1.00      0.89      2553
         toj       1.00      0.05      0.09      4002
         too       1.00      0.40      0.57      2315
         top       0.99      0.95      0.97      4995
         tos       0.52      1.00      0.69      3005
         tpt       1.00      0.37      0.54      2206
         trc       0.99      0.99      0.99      2000
         trq       0.93      1.00      0.96      2000
         tsz       0.94      0.92      0.93      2359
         ttc       0.97      0.96      0.97      2002
         tur       1.00      0.76      0.87     15000
         tzh       0.99      0.90      0.94      2002
         tzj       0.76      0.97      0.85      2000
         tzt       0.88      0.92      0.90      2001
         tzu       1.00      0.37      0.54      2016
         urd       1.00      0.97      0.98     12451
         usp       0.78      0.91      0.84      2003
         vec       0.46      0.91      0.61      2036
         vie       0.99      0.99      0.99     12007
         vmy       1.00      0.84      0.91      2079
         xtd       1.00      0.65      0.79      2000
         xtm       1.00      0.76      0.86      2000
         yaq       1.00      0.09      0.17      2011
         yua       1.00      0.92      0.96      2006
         zaa       0.61      0.99      0.76      2000
         zab       0.95      0.92      0.93      2003
         zac       1.00      0.89      0.94      2000
         zad       1.00      0.18      0.30      2017
         zai       1.00      0.94      0.97      4014
         zam       0.97      0.97      0.97      2001
         zao       1.00      0.19      0.32      2000
         zar       1.00      0.50      0.66      2005
         zas       0.34      0.99      0.51      2005
         zat       0.85      0.99      0.91      2006
         zav       1.00      0.90      0.95      2035
         zaw       0.94      0.97      0.95      2029
         zca       1.00      0.70      0.82      2000
         zho       0.39      1.00      0.56     12409
         zos       1.00      0.75      0.86      2091
         zpc       1.00      0.00      0.00      2006
         zpi       1.00      0.82      0.90      2001
         zpl       1.00      0.24      0.39      2002
         zpm       1.00      0.51      0.68      2000
         zpo       1.00      0.75      0.85      2000
         zpq       1.00      0.51      0.68      2007
         zpt       1.00      0.35      0.52      2000
         zpu       1.00      0.13      0.22      2001
         zpv       1.00      0.75      0.86      2003
         zpz       1.00      0.57      0.73      2000
         zsr       0.73      0.95      0.83      2000
         ztq       1.00      0.85      0.92      2000
         zty       0.82      0.98      0.89      2001

    accuracy                           0.81    870104
   macro avg       0.92      0.76      0.77    870104
weighted avg       0.91      0.81      0.80    870104
